Transaction c4ca63b204f8af914ca04a96786260b9dff4540ce973ab8b78ee4dc82d912e09
1 Input
1 Output
-
c4ca63b204f8af914ca04a96786260b9dff4540ce973ab8b78ee4dc82d912e09:0
- value
- 4595165
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8615eed79adda066afa9e4468aef7f688db0e306 OP_EQUAL
- address
- 3DuzkBLTSYXAfk7pmSZD5qJq7nyEHNxXab